Page 22 - LCD Display; Block Separator Line; LCD Display & Keyboard
22 LCD Display & Keyboard GETTING STARTED LCD Display 1. Line number Indicates line number within the label layout. 2. Shift Mode Indicates shift mode is on. 3. Start Line / 4. End Line The area between the start and end line will be printed.The short lines extending from the start/end lines sho...
Page 23 - Key Names and Functions; Displays a preview of the label.; Shift
23 G E TTIN G STA R TED LCD Display & Keyboard Key Names and Functions 1. Power Turns the P-touch labeler on and off. 2. Print Options Enables Numbering or Mirror to be selected and printed. 3. Preview Displays a preview of the label. 4. Feed & Cut Feeds 0.96" (24.5mm) of blank tape th...

Page 29 - Check that the end of the tape is not bent and that it passes; Inserting a Tape Cassette
29 G E TTIN G STA R TED Inserting a Tape Cassette Tape cassettes of 0.13", 0.23", 0.35", 0.47", 0.70" or 0.94" (3.5mm, 6mm, 9mm, 12mm, 18mm or 24mm) width can be used in your P-touch labeler. Use only Brother tape cassettes with the mark. Check that the end of the tape is n...
